100 Bullets: Brother Lono #6
The penultimate chapter of Azzarello and Risso's 100 Bullets spin-off arrives with one of the series' most striking covers — a nun in full habit, rendered in sickly green tones, leveling two semi-automatic pistols while a skull-adorned cross looms below and dark roses frame the scene, with a banner reading "¡La Canción de los Torturados!" cutting across the image. Dave Johnson's cover design fuses religious iconography with unambiguous menace, setting a mood that feels both devotional and deeply dangerous. If you've been following Lono's descent into the cartel-shadowed world Azzarello and Risso built in 100 Bullets, issue six of eight promises the tension is still ratcheting upward.
